Fishing Vessel Taking on Water off Southern Oregon Coast. Oregon Coast. 1. On June 13, 2023, the USCG Sector Columbia River notified the SSC for the Pacific Northwest that the 47’ F/V Nadine is taking on water off the southern Oregon coast. Search and rescue operations rescued all persons on board. There is max. potential for 1200 gallons of diesel and 100 gallons of hydraulic oil on board, no oil is observed to have released. A trajectory was requested. 2. THREAT: OIL. COMMODITY: DIESEL & HYDRAULIC OIL. MAXIMUM POTENTIAL RELEASE: 1200 GALLONS. TAGS: ADRIFT. 3. POSITION 42.656N 124.516W.
